Braking mode of turbine expander

In order to control the speed of the turbine expander, make it run at the highest efficiency point, and prevent runaway, each turbine expander shall be equipped with a braking device. The commonly used braking forms include fan braking, motor braking and booster braking. The brake cost of the fan is low, and the operation is convenient, but the power cannot be recovered, and the noise is large. It is only used for the brake of small and medium-sized expanders; The motor brake has no noise and can recover power as electric energy, but the equipment cost is high. Only the large oxygen concentrator is equipped with a turbine expander with motor brake; The booster brake increases the inlet pressure of the expander and recovers the expansion work to the oxygen generator itself, which is a relatively advanced brake form.

Generally, the actual cooling capacity of expander is always less than the theoretical cooling capacity. Under the same inlet and outlet pressure and inlet gas temperature, the lower the efficiency of expander, the smaller the unit refrigerant cooling capacity and the smaller the temperature drop efficiency of expander. The efficiency of expander depends on the size of various losses inside the expander. Due to the existence of various losses, the ability of gas to do external work is reduced in varying degrees.
